Definition : Offer

An offer is a proposal or suggestion made to someone, typically with the intention of entering into a transaction or agreement. It is an expression of willingness to provide something, whether it be a product, service, or opportunity, in exchange for something else. An offer can also refer to an opportunity or invitation presented to someone, such as a job offer or an offer to participate in an event.
